Field re-entrant superconductivity in Eu-doped infinite-layer nickelates

Chuanying Xi, Danfeng Li, Guangli Kuang, Haoliang Huang, Heng Wang, Jiayin Tang, Jinfeng Xu, Junfeng Wang, Liang Li, Li Pi, Mingwei Yang, Ming Yang, Qikun Xue, Qingyou Lu, Sixia Hu, Wenjie Meng, Wenjing Xu, Xianfeng Wu, Ze Wang, Zhicheng Pei, Zhuoyu Chen, Ziqiang Wang

Eu doping creates a re-entrant superconducting phase that returns under high magnetic fields in over-doped infinite-layer nickelates.

Claims

C1strongest claim

Eu-doped infinite-layer nickelate Sm_{0.95-x}Ca_{0.05}Eu_xNiO_2 exhibits a magnetic-field-induced re-entrant superconducting phase in the Eu-rich over-doped regime, confirmed by zero-resistance transport and high-field diamagnetic screening.

C2weakest assumption

The interpretation that zero-resistance transport combined with diamagnetic screening unambiguously establishes a true superconducting phase rather than an anomalous metallic or other non-superconducting state, and that the observed deviations from the Eu-exchange-field compensation model reflect new physics rather than experimental artifacts or sample inhomogeneity.

C3one line summary

Eu-doped infinite-layer nickelates exhibit field-induced re-entrant superconductivity in the over-doped regime, with nonlinear Hall transport and hysteretic magnetoresistance indicating unconventional behavior.
